The Pan American Health Organization (PAHO) recognizes the importance of a new generation of public health leaders who have a clear understanding of global health issues, the role international organizations play in achieving the Millennium Development Goals (MDGs), as well as addressing critical health needs.
In this regard, the PAHO Internship Program (IP) aims to train dedicated and passionate individuals entering the field of public health who are interested in providing services to PAHO. PAHO interns are matched both in-person and virtually with appropriate technical or administrative programs based on their personal interests and skills. Placement opportunities are available at PAHO Headquarters in Washington, D.C., PAHO Country Offices, as well as the Pan American Centers in South America.
